Where do you find names for your characters?

Does anyone else really struggle to come up with the names for their characters? I often find that I have stories in my head ready to write but spend hours trying to find the right names for the characters. I can imagine everything about them but names just escape me. Does anyone have tips on how to come up with names?

Spammers! If they use a name as opposed to gobbledygook. You'd be surprised how well their names fit with my villains and unsavoury characters. And, as a bonus; revenge without jail time!

I also check film credits. Best boy, key grips, dolly operators, etc, often have names that I can mix and match to create new and unusual ones.

The names for my characters sometimes just come to me and other times I think about using a name that was in the family or a name that I have come across that I particularly like. Most of the time though, I think about what kind of character I want to create and then find a name that might go with it. If I create a foreign character from a certain country I like to research a bit and find a name that is truly from that part of the world. Names too have to project the character like if you have a John Paterson or a Jane Willows they sound like business people who may be middle aged. If you name someone Tyler Walker it could be a younger person, a pop star, an actor. It's upto you to put the character to the name not the other way round.
